Plant Dreaming: A Leeds Art Gallery Late

Join us at the art gallery for a very special late opening event, rooted in the visions and ideas of current exhibition Plant Dreaming: An exhibition of works about plants, and their real and imagined histories.

On the eve of the Spring Equinox, join us to enjoy botanically themed activites, performance, screenings and talks. Plus an exclusive cocktail and food menu in The Tiled Hall cafe.*

And of course, exhibitions Plant Dreaming and 'Don’t Let’s Ask For the Moon..': Nocturnes and Atkinson Grimshaw will also be open for visitors to enjoy after dark.

The shop will also be open for you to pick up some gorgeous Plant Dreaming inspired gifts on the night.
